45 Hour Post License Real Estate Florida Test Questions With Answers Latest Updated 2024/2025 (100% Correct) The three types of operating expenses of an income property are A) fixed, debt service, and reserves for replacements. B) reserves for replacements, fixed, and variable. C) variable, income taxes, and fixed. D) reserves for replacements, variable, and income taxes. correct answers B) reserves for replacements, fixed, and variable. Explanation Operating expenses are divided into three categories: fixed expenses, variable expenses, and reserves for replacement. A person applies for a $300,000, 30-year fixed-rate mortgage loan at 4%. The mortgage payment factor is .. Taxes for the year are $4,000, and insurance is $2,400. Her monthly payment for principal, interest, taxes, and insurance (PITI) will be A) $1,432.25. B) $1,773.64. C) $1,273.64. D) 45 Hour Post License Real Estate Florida Test Questions With Answers Latest Updated 2024/2025 $1,965.58. correct answers D) $1,965.58. 58. $300,000 × . = $1,432.25 principal and interest. $4,000 taxes ÷ 12 months = 333.33. $2,400 insurance ÷ 12 months = 200. $1,432.25 + $333.33 + $200 = $1,965.58 total PITI. A sales associate receives a good-faith deposit from a buyer on Wednesday. The broker must deposit the funds into the escrow account no later than the following A) Tuesday. B) Monday. C) Thursday. D) Friday. correct answers B) Monday. FREC rules require that the sales associate must give the broker the funds within one business day. The broker must deposit the funds in a bank within three business days. Antitrust laws A) allow brokers to boycott cut-rate brokers' listings. B) prohibit commercial advertising in faxes. C) allow brokers to split up market areas. D) prohibit price fixing. correct answers D) prohibit price fixing. Explanation Some of the prohibited actions under antitrust laws include: conspiracy to set prices; splitting up competitive market areas; conspiring to boycott cut-rate brokers or otherwise interfering with their business; and requiring a minimum commission before allowing listings to be circulated in any service, such as through an MLS.
